Description: ## Earth Observation Datasets
        
        [![Build Status](https://travis-ci.org/GeoscienceAustralia/eo-datasets.svg?branch=eodatasets3)](https://travis-ci.org/GeoscienceAustralia/eo-datasets)
        [![Coverage Status](https://coveralls.io/repos/GeoscienceAustralia/eo-datasets/badge.svg?branch=eodatasets3)](https://coveralls.io/r/GeoscienceAustralia/eo-datasets?branch=eodatasets3)
        
        Packaging, metadata and provenance libraries for GA EO datasets. See [LICENSE](LICENSE) for
        license details.
        
        ### Installation
        
            pip install -e .
        
        Python 3.6+ is supported. A [GDAL](http://www.gdal.org/) installation is required 
        to use most packaging commands.
        
        ### Development
        
        Run tests using [pytest](http://pytest.org/).
        
            pytest
        
        All code is formatted using [black](https://github.com/ambv/black), and checked
        with [pyflakes](https://github.com/PyCQA/pyflakes).
        
        They are included when installing the test dependencies:
        
            pip install -e .[test]
        
        You may want to configure your editor to run black automatically on file save
        (see the Black page for directions), or install the pre-commit hook within Git:
        
        ### Pre-commit setup
        
        A [pre-commit](https://pre-commit.com/) config is provided to automatically format
        and check your code changes. This allows you to immediately catch and fix
        issues before you raise a failing pull request (which run the same checks under
        Travis).
        
        If you don't use Conda, install pre-commit from pip:
        
            pip install pre-commit
        
        If you do use Conda, install from conda-forge (*required* because the pip
        version uses virtualenvs which are incompatible with Conda's environments)
        
            conda install pre_commit
        
        Now install the pre-commit hook to the current repository:
        
            pre-commit install
        
        Your code will now be formatted and validated before each commit. You can also
        invoke it manually by running `pre-commit run`
        
            
        
        ### Included Scripts
        
        `eo3-validate` a lint-like checker to check ODC metadata.
        
             $ eo3-validate --help
            Usage: eo3-validate [OPTIONS] [PATHS]...
            
              Validate ODC dataset documents
            
              Paths can be both product and dataset documents, but each product must
              come before its datasets to be matched against it.
            
            Options:
              -W, --warnings-as-errors  Fail if any warnings are produced
              --thorough                Attempt to read the data/measurements, and check
                                        their properties match the product
              -q, --quiet               Only print problems, one per line
              --help                    Show this message and exit.
        
        `eo3-prepare`: Prepare ODC metadata from the commandline.
        
        Some preparers need the ancillary dependencies: `pip install .[ancillary]`
        
             $ eo3-prepare --help
            Usage: eo3-prepare [OPTIONS] COMMAND [ARGS]...
            
            Options:
              --version  Show the version and exit.
              --help     Show this message and exit.
            
            Commands:
              landsat-l1     Prepare eo3 metadata for USGS Landsat Level 1 data.
              modis-mcd43a1  Prepare MODIS MCD43A1 tiles for indexing into a Data...
              noaa-prwtr     Prepare NCEP/NCAR reanalysis 1 water pressure datasets...
              s2-awspds      Preparation code for Sentinel-2 L1C AWS PDS Generates...
              s2-cophub      Preparation code for Sentinel-2 L1C SCIHUB ZIP Generates...
        
        `eo3-package-wagl`: Convert and package WAGL HDF5 outputs.
        
         Needs the wagl dependencies group: `pip install .[wagl]`
             
             $ eo3-package-wagl --help
            Usage: eo3-package-wagl [OPTIONS] H5_FILE
            
              Package WAGL HDF5 Outputs
            
              This will convert the HDF5 file (and sibling fmask/gqa files) into
              GeoTIFFS (COGs) with datacube metadata using the DEA naming conventions
              for files.
            
            Options:
              --level1 FILE                   Optional path to the input level1 metadata
                                              doc (otherwise it will be loaded from the
                                              level1 path in the HDF5)
              --output DIRECTORY              Put the output package into this directory
                                              [required]
              -p, --product [nbar|nbart|lambertian|sbt]
                                              Package only the given products (can specify
                                              multiple times)
              --with-oa / --no-oa             Include observation attributes (default:
                                              true)
              --help                          Show this message and exit.
        
        `eo3-to-stac`: Convert an ODC metadata to a Stac Item json file (BETA/Incomplete)
        
             $ eo3-to-stac --help
            Usage: eo3-to-stac [OPTIONS] [ODC_METADATA_FILES]...
            
              Convert a new-style ODC metadata doc to a Stac Item.
            
            Options:
              --help  Show this message and exit.
